The legacy of AKA continues to reverberate within the South African music community, particularly among those who shared close bonds with the late rapper. L-Tido, a fellow artist and friend, recently found himself reflecting on AKA’s prescient social media post regarding the ANC’s fate, showcasing the enduring impact of AKA’s words long after his passing.

In a striking display of foresight, AKA took to social media platform X (formerly Twitter) following the 2019 National Elections to deliver a bold proclamation regarding the ANC’s future. Despite the party’s electoral success at the time, AKA’s assertion that the ANC was “f*k*g DONE” resonated with a profound sense of truth and foresight.

Fast forward to the present, and AKA’s prophetic words have found poignant validation in the wake of the ANC’s faltering performance in the recent National Elections. L-Tido, among others, acknowledges the prescience of AKA’s prediction, recognizing the significance of his insights amidst the unfolding political landscape.
